Wolfe Research initiated coverage of Uber with an Outperform rating and $90 price target as part of a broader sector note launching coverage of Global Internet names. The company maintains a solid competitive moat and delivers healthy fundamental trends while benefiting from stable demand trends for its core products and unlocking growth opportunities with new categories, products, verticals, and geographic markets, the analyst tells investors in a research note. Wolfe also gives the stock a Top Pick designations thanks to Uber’s sustainable, high-teens topline growth, meaningful margin expansion, and healthy free cash flows.
